• Django配置日志


    Django如何使用内建的logging模块

    保存输出的日志记录
    添加配置日志输出报错

    ValueError: Unable to configure handler 'file
    

    这个设置日志的文件还需重新写个脚本(预计)
    实则打脸,并不需要。
    我路径没有配对.错误的路径

    # 这里应该写完整路径,或者用os.path.join加入
    'filename': 'log/debug.log'
    

    正确的路径

    'handlers': { # 实际处理日志的地方 # 还有一个模块Filters 是信息从logger传递到handler的过程中实施一些过滤行为
        'file': {
          'level': 'DEBUG', # 执行runserver时候浏览需要访问数据库的页面,在shell中即可看见相关日志
          'class': 'logging.FileHandler',
          'filename':os.path.join(BASE_DIR, 'log/debug.log')
        },
      }
    

    打印出数据库的语句

    只要在loggers这里配置:django.db.backends即可。
    默认一般是django.

    常用的配置级别

    除了django和django.db.backends之外还有django.request,django.server

  • 相关阅读:
    模板
    洛谷
    Codeforces
    Codeforces
    Codeforces
    Codeforces
    洛谷
    洛谷
    洛谷
    NOIP 普及组 2016 海港
  • 原文地址:https://www.cnblogs.com/wkhzwmr/p/16013191.html
Copyright © 2020-2023  润新知